Kohärentes
Kohärentes refers to a state of internal consistency and harmony. In physics, it specifically describes waves, such as light waves, that maintain a constant phase relationship over time and space. This property is crucial for phenomena like interference and diffraction, where the precise alignment of wave crests and troughs determines the observed patterns. For instance, lasers produce highly coherent light, which is why they can be focused to a tiny spot and used in applications ranging from optical communication to surgery.
